Luca tried to not question too deeply his satisfaction when Moniqueâs lids fluttered down over her eyes in appreciation as she sampled her first Italian gelato.
âThis is delicious!â
If forced to guess her favourite flavour, heâd have said chocolate, but sheâd pointed to a creamy passionfruit instead. Normally heâd choose a coffee-flavoured gelato, but not today. Today heâd selected a rich smooth caramel that coated his tongue in sweet promise.
Her eyes flew open, rooting him to the spot. âBest gelato ever.â
He couldnât move, couldnât drag his gaze from those eyes, her smile or from the life that radiated from her every pore. As if aware of his scrutiny, as if the warmth of his gaze touched her skin, pink stained her cheeks.
He shook himself. âI am glad it does not disappoint. And what of the fountain?â He gestured to the fountain in front of them. âDoes it too live up to expectation?â
âI think it magnificent. I need to pinch myself to believe Iâm really here and that this isnât just a dream.â
She craned her neck, taking in all she could. As if trying to memorise every detail. He did his best not to notice the way her tongue touched the gelato or the shine it left on her lips. If he kissed her now, sheâd taste cool and tangy andâ
Not that he had any intention of doing any such thing!
Sì, she was beautiful, but a dalliance with Benitoâs godmother...? Dio, it would be very poor form indeed. Besides, he reminded himself, for as long as he continued to tread delicate ground with Signor Romano, he would not want whispers of any such liaison to reach the older manâs ears.
If only those thoughts could dampen the tendrils of desire that curled around him with a gentle but insidious tyranny. He took a big bite of gelato, hoping it would give him brain freeze.
âThe fountain and the square are both regal and charming,â Monique finally said. âI suspect that might sum Rome up perfectly too.â
Except that was all conjecture on her part, and not based on experience. How could he have been so remiss and not shown her a little of what Rome had to offer before now? Heâd kept her tied to the villa for the nearly three weeks. She mustâve felt as if she were under house arrest!
âYou sum up my city perfectly.â He handed her a coin and gestured. âYou must, of course, toss a coin into the fountain to ensure you will one day return.â
Her fingers closed around the coin as if relishing the heat it had absorbed from his body. He gulped down more gelato.
Placing her back to the fountain and closing her eyes as if to make a wish, she threw the coin high into the air over her shoulder. It glittered in the sunlight as it turned over and over, landing in the pool with a splash.
He beamed at her. âNow you will return.â
âI hope so.â
He would see to it. He wanted Benito to know his godmother, and to know her well, not just as a passing acquaintance.
